  • Can I get a taxi from Wrocław airport

    Yes, taxi companies such as EcoCar and Partner Taxi operate at Wrocław airport. They can take you to a number of different destinations, and you can expect to pay different amounts depending on the length of the journey. For example, you can expect to pay roughly zł25 (£5) to the Wrocław Fashion Outlet, zł50 (£10) to the city centre, and zł60 (£11) to the main railway station.

  • How do I get from the airport to downtown Wrocław by bus?

    You can catch the number 106 bus from the airport, which will take you into the city centre with a stop at Dworcowa Street, close to the main railway station, although it is better if you depart at Podwale Street, where a walk to the city centre is just 10min. The bus service begins at around 05:30 and runs until about 23:30, a journey takes just more than 30mintes, and a single adult ticket costs approximately zł3.40 (£0.65).

  • Are there hotels near to Wrocław airport?

    Yes, near to Wrocław airport you will find a number of top hotels, which are ideal for getting some quality rest immediately after your flight. The Hotel Kosmonauty Wroclaw-Airport is just 5min from the airport and operates a free shuttle service to take guests to and from their flight, while other options include Terminal Hotel, Karczma Rzym, and Ibis Budget Wrocław Stadion.

  • How far is Wrocław Strachowice Airport from central Wrocław?

    You’ll need to travel 6 miles to reach the Wrocław city centre from Wrocław Strachowice Airport.

  • What is the name of Wrocław’s airport?

    Wrocław is served by Wrocław Strachowice Airport, also commonly referred to as Copernicus Airport Wroclaw, Strachowice, or Wroclaw–Copernicus. The airport code is WRO.

  • Car hire desks can be found in front of the baggage claim and at Wrocław airport (WRO), where there are representatives from top companies including Avis, Europcar, Hertz and SIXT.
  • If travelling to another destination in Poland or across Europe, you can catch a long-distance bus directly from Wrocław Airport, where a number of companies operate.
  • If you are getting picked up from the airport, the driver can take advantage of the Kiss & Fly zone which allows cars to access the airport for up to 10min free-of-charge.
  • If you have some time to pass after arriving at the airport, you can enjoy great views of the planes landing and taking off from the Observation Desk on Level 2.
  • If travelling with babies, you can find changing facilities near the main restrooms at Wrocław Airport, where you can take care of your children as necessary.
  • There are four belts at the baggage reclaim area Wrocław airport (WRO), and you can consult the monitors to know on which belt your baggage will be available. If your bags do not arrive, then you will need to contact the Lost Baggage Office, which can be found to the left of the exit from the baggage reclaim.
